Abstract
In this work a series of recognized fatigue strength evaluation methods are applied on two notched shot peened specimens under different fatigue loading. After having considered the approaches based on fracture mechanics (see Part 1), now the local stress methods and the FKM guideline (which includes both a nominal stress approach and a local stress one) are considered. The results allow evidencing the criteria able to better consider the effect of SP and to underline the critical points related to the application of the mentioned criteria to shot peened parts. In this regard the FKM guideline and the approach based on critical distance theory are found to provide more accurate results.
